As has been pointed out at www.nastyz28.com the Arizona 70 Z has some issues.......like R/S front end added to a Camaro W/O Style Trim option(which all Z-22 R/S's included),
Non Original Right front fender, No wood grain horn shroud that would have matched wood gauge bezel if car REALLY had interior decor group....and this is a 70 Z asking $40K+ what a load of #@&*%!!!!! I cant even imagine hlow many other things are missing or incorrect. Any $40K+ 70 Z should be DEAD NUTS perfect IMHO......Phils's car in comparison is PRICELESS!!!
